3 Benefits to Bringing Baby to the Dentist by 1

August 19, 2016 Anna Keefe

Your baby needs to see the dentist by the age of 1! Read why:

Early teethers, gummy smiles and all babies in between, need to see the dentist by age 1. The American Dental Association’s recommendation is based on firsts. Babies should visit the dentist: • Within 6 months of getting a first tooth; and • No later than their first birthday … [Read more...]
